# Java 区分用户 Session 教程
在现代的 Web 应用程序中,用户会话管理是一个重要的环节。使用 Java 实现用户 Session 可以帮助我们保持用户的状态信息,确保用户在网站内的活动不会丢失。这篇文章将指导你通过具体的步骤,教会你如何实现 Java 中的用户 Session 区分。
## 流程概览
首先,我们需要了解实现用户 Session 的基本流程。下表展示了实现 S
# linux应急响应--------### Linux快捷键 ctrl + a 跳到行首ctrl + e 跳到行尾ctrl + u 删除光标前内容ctrl + k 删除光标后内容## 入侵排查思路 账号安全 -> 历史命令 -> 检查异常端口 -> 检查异常进程 -> 检查开机启动项 -> 检查定时任务 -> 检查服务 ->
在开发中遇到这样一个问题:安装任意第三方的一个apk,恢复出厂设置,再次安装相同的apk,提示安装失败,通过打印LOG发现,安装失败的错误反回值是24,public static final int INSTALL_FAILED_UID_CHANGED = -24 ; 进一步跟踪发现,在恢复出厂设置后/data/data目录下的第三方应用的文件夹还在,手动删除此文件后再次安装就会成功,按正常逻辑恢
转载
2024-09-16 11:15:17
30阅读
本文转自:我将原文的控件进行了一些修改,去掉了原来控件的外边框,只留下重要的遮罩、背景和滑块。并且可以在布局文件中预览(预览效果不是太好,凑合看看还可以)。自己修改了下监听器,增加了一些方法。总之目前已经和官方的控件差不多了。重要的是可以自定义控件的大小了!上面粉红色的那个就是我们自定义的控件了,下面的两个是用的官方的控件,自己改样式。基本处于没用的级别。好了,现在我们开始讲自定义控件添加入代码中
检查 GeoIP 是否安装 首先需要确认当前安装的 Nginx 是否安装了 GeoIP 模块 123456 $ nginx -Vnginx version: nginx/1.12.2built by gcc 4.8.5 20150623 (Red Hat 4.8.5-11) (GCC)built w
转载
2020-06-17 11:15:00
426阅读
2评论
# Java如何区分用户是否已登录
## 引言
在Web应用程序中,用户登录是常见的功能之一。为了区分用户是否已经登录,我们可以使用多种方式,如使用Session、Cookie、Token等。本文将介绍使用Session和Token两种方式来区分用户是否已经登录。
## 使用Session来区分用户是否已登录
### 什么是Session
Session是一种服务器端的会话机制,用于在服
原创
2023-12-25 06:06:52
169阅读
与传统B/S模式的Web系统不同,移动端APP与服务器之间的接口交互一般是C/S模式,这种情况下如果涉及到用户登录的话,就不能像Web系统那样依赖于Web容器来管理Session了,因为APP每发一次请求都会在服务器端创建一个新的Session。而有些涉及到用户隐私或者资金交易的接口又必须确认当前用户登录的合法性,如果没有登录或者登录已过期则不能进行此类操作。 我见过一种“偷懒”的方式,就是在用
转载
2024-09-12 11:20:09
80阅读
一、Pvlan知识点二、PVLAN配置案例(cisco)1、设置主VLANSW1(config)#vlan 200 private-vlan primary 2、设置二级子VLANSW1(config)#vlan 201 private-vlan isolated 设置为隔离VLANSW1(config)#vlan 202&n
转载
2024-08-12 17:22:37
473阅读
# Android Room 分用户
在Android开发中,使用数据库是非常常见和重要的操作之一。而Room是Android Jetpack组件中的一个持久性库,用于简化数据库操作。Room提供了一种方便的方式来处理数据库操作,使得开发者可以更加轻松地进行数据存储和检索。
然而,在实际开发中,经常会遇到需要为不同用户保存不同数据的情况。这时候,如何在Room中实现分用户存储就成为了一个问题。
原创
2023-07-29 09:59:26
228阅读
Android Service 分用户
## 引言
在 Android 应用程序开发中,Service 是一个常用的组件,用于在后台执行长时间运行的任务或处理耗时的操作。然而,有时候我们需要将一个 Service 的功能分发给不同的用户,以实现不同用户之间的隔离,这就是所谓的 "Service 分用户"。
本文将介绍如何在 Android 应用程序中实现 Service 分用户的功能,并提供代
原创
2023-10-08 12:28:15
280阅读
1 什么是RedisRedis(Remote Dictionary Server) 是⼀个使⽤ C 语⾔编写的,开源的(BSD许可)⾼性能⾮关系型(NoSQL)的键值对数据库。
Redis 可以存储键和五种不同类型的值之间的映射。键的类型只能为字符串,值⽀持五种数据类型:字符串、列
表、集合、散列表、有序集合。
与传统数据库不同的是 Redis 的数据是存在内存中的,所以读写速度⾮常快,因此
一、实验目的 1、熟悉NFS文件系统配置的过程和方法,为嵌入式开发打下基础。 2、了解NFS文件系统在嵌入式开发的重要作用。 二、实验内容 1、准备两台安装ubuntu系统的PC机,测试两台机器是否能够连通。2、搭建NFS服务器:(1)使用apt-get update命令更新系统软件包(2)使用apt-get命令安装nfs-kernel-server(3)作为服务端,新建nfs共享目录并设置目录文
转载
2024-04-09 14:44:55
80阅读
在把用户故事切分成小块,从而更好地利用敏捷技术时,很多新组建的敏捷团队都会遇到困难。 敏捷社区的成员在多篇文章中为如何有效地切分用户故事提供了指导。 当把庞大的用户故事切分成小块时,是否有一些一般的准则供我们遵循呢?Rachel Davies建议对每个用户故事都要进行切分,从而让产出的软件:能够工作交付价值能有效地得到用户的反馈Richard Lawrence提供了以下技术,他认为在切分大型用户
转载
精选
2014-05-05 13:25:32
360阅读
企业签名的app有的用户能安装,有的用户安装失败。
最近在做企业签名后,有客户反馈,客户的手机能安装,但是别人的手机安装不了。
一般有3种情况:
1、首先确保配置文件info.plist里面都添加了SSL证书(HTTPS)。
2、开发人员打包的时候是否选择适配了低版本系统的手机。
比如客户手机是iOS10系统,打包的ipa最低支持iOS11,这就会造成 无
在把用户故事切分成小块,从而更好地利用敏捷技术时,很多新组建的敏捷团队都会遇到困难。 敏捷社区的成员在多篇文章
转载
2011-04-28 09:22:00
147阅读
2评论
# Java如何根据字符串区分用户调用的哪个接口
在实际开发中,我们常常需要根据用户输入的字符串来调用不同的接口。在Java中,我们可以利用反射机制来实现这一功能。下面我们将演示如何根据用户输入的字符串区分用户调用的哪个接口,并提供一个具体的示例来解决一个问题。
## 反射机制简介
反射是Java语言的一个特性,它允许程序在运行时检查和修改其结构。通过反射,我们可以动态地创建对象、调用方法、
原创
2024-03-24 07:26:06
17阅读
简介在 Redis 6.0 中引入了 ACL(Access Control List) 的支持,在此前的版本中 Redis 中是没有用户的概念的,也就不能根据username来精确的划分其权限,Redis client端也就没有username这个参数。redis 6.0 开始支持用户,可以给每个用户分配不同的权限来控制权限。目前redis常用的client——Jedis和Lettuce也对其做了
转载
2024-02-02 14:19:49
215阅读
## 分用户的 Linux Java 版本实现流程
以下是分用户的 Linux Java 版本实现的流程图:
```mermaid
flowchart TD
A[创建用户] --> B[编写 Java 程序]
B --> C[编译 Java 程序]
C --> D[创建用户配置文件]
D --> E[启动用户程序]
```
### 1. 创建用户
首先,需要
原创
2023-10-26 04:06:30
50阅读
# 微服务拆分用户中心实现流程
## 1. 确定微服务拆分的边界
首先,我们需要确定用户中心的微服务拆分边界,将用户相关的功能划分到不同的微服务中。根据业务需求和功能特点,可以确定以下拆分边界:
| 微服务名称 | 功能描述 |
|------------|--------------------------------------|
|
原创
2024-01-10 04:05:02
72阅读
图书管理系统1. 描述a> 角色b> 操作2. 实现a> Book 类b> BookList 类c> IOperation 操作接口d> AddBook 类e> DeleteBook 类f> UpdateBook 类g> FindBook 类h> BorrowBook 类i> ReturnBook 类j> DisplayBo
转载
2023-12-21 11:13:44
94阅读